Ep. 155 | The Psychology Behind Real Estate Decisions

<p>Buying or selling a home should be exciting, but for many, it comes with a hidden weight. Even when the numbers make sense, the decisions feel heavy. Buyers freeze at the last second, even after getting approved. Sellers accept offers and immediately wonder if they made a mistake. It’s the silent fear that no one talks about, the fear of regret, of losing freedom, of choosing wrong.</p><p>In this episode, we explore the psychology behind these fears and why real estate can feel so terrifying, even when logic is on your side. We break down what’s happening in the minds of buyers and sellers, and how emotions often outweigh facts. From worrying about mortgages to feeling nostalgic about a home, these fears are real and surprisingly universal.</p><p>We dive into questions like</p><p>• What drives buyer hesitation even when the perfect home appears </p><p>• How social pressure and fear of making a mistake influence decisions </p><p>• Why sellers feel regret or guilt after accepting an offer </p><p>• The shared psychology of timing, control, and pride in real estate </p><p>• How emotions can outweigh numbers in both buying and selling</p><p>If you’ve ever wondered why committing to a home feels so hard, this episode gives you insight, perspective, and a deeper understanding of the silent fears that shape the market.</p><p>Subscribe for more conversations on real estate, market insights, and the psychology behind buying and selling decisions.</p><p><br></p>
